The music industry is taking a day to reflect on Tuesday (June 2) as part of Blackout Tuesday/#TheShowMustBePaused, an industry-wide effort to "disconnect from work and reconnect with our community."In conjunction with the day of reflection -- which was coordinated by Atlantic Records executives Jamila Thomas and Brianna Agyemang in reaction to the police-involved killings of Breonna Taylor, George Floyd and others -- the Movement 4 Black Lives, a coalition of 100 black-led organizations, is calling for five days of action, each focused on a specific set of demands."It feels important to really move the needle on how we’re relating right now and call for very specific national asks that people can drill down at a local level in response to.
